Five men from Punjab have been arrested in Onatrio, Canada, for stealing a trailer carrying cannabis worth over $2 million. Police also recovered two illegal firearms from them.
The Auto Cargo Theft Unit (ACTU) of the York Regional Police arrested the Indian-origin men following the recovery of the stolen consignment and weapons.
The accused, Manveer Singh, 21, Sarbjeet Singh, 32, Dilkhab Singh, 21, Jaiskavan Malhi, 23, all residents of Brampton, and Karan Kumar, 25, of Hamilton, face multiple charges.
The charges include theft of $5,000 involving a motor vehicle, possession of property obtained by crime over $5,000, trafficking in stolen property, and several firearms-related offences, and unauthorized possession of firearms in a vehicle.
On April 15, 2026, police located a trailer at McLaughlin Road in Mississauga that was stolen from Niagara Region, containing a large amount of cannabis products to be delivered to various dispensaries. Identifying that the several men were linked to the stolen trailer, the police arrested the five Indian-origin men.
York Regional Police said they were investigating auto and cargo thefts across the York Region and the Greater Toronto Area, in association with the Equite Association.
